Revenue and income statement
In 2024, PAPREC FRANCE achieves revenue of 876.5 M€. Over the period 2015-2024, the company shows strong growth with a CAGR (compound annual growth rate) of +9.9%. Vs 2023, growth of +21% (725.5 M€ -> 876.5 M€). After deducting consumption (511.4 M€), gross margin stands at 365.1 M€, i.e. a rate of 42%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 53.1 M€, representing 6.1% of revenue. Positive scissor effect: EBITDA margin improves by +3.2 pts, sign of improved operational efficiency. The operating margin remains fragile, requiring cost vigilance.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 31.0 M€, i.e. 3.5%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ios
The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 725%. Critical situation: debt significantly exceeds equity, severely limiting borrowing capacity and exposing the company to default risk.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 11%. Low autonomy: the company heavily depends on external financing (banks, suppliers).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 22.0 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. Beyond 7 years, banks generally consider credit risk as high. Cash flow represents 6.7%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. Satisfactory level allowing partial financing of growth.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ms
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 61 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 43 days. The company must finance 18 days of gap between collections and payments. Inventory turnover is 1 days (= Average inventory / Cost of goods x 360). Fast turnover, sign of good inventory management. Overall, WCR represents 273 days of revenue, i.e. 664.3 M€ to permanently finance. Over 2015-2024, WCR increased by +256%, requiring additional financing.
